Ich verwende (Windows) SourceTree für mein Git-Projekt. Ich kann es entweder in der Eingabeaufforderung oder im Linux-Terminal tun.
Aber ich frage mich, ob es eine gute Möglichkeit gibt, Konflikte interaktiv und visuell zu lösen. Wenn Pull beispielsweise Konflikte erkennt, wird ein GUI-basiertes Konflikttool (z. B. P4Merge) angezeigt. Ist es möglich?
Ich löse immer manuell Konflikte, was nur schmerzhaft ist.
Dies ist beispielsweise eine Git- pull
Nachricht von SourceTree.
git -c diff.mnemonicprefix=false -c core.quotepath=false pull --no-commit origin master
From W:\repo\
* branch master -> FETCH_HEAD
Updating 33c07bf..41e0249
error: Your local changes to the following files would be overwritten by merge:
foo.cpp
goo.cpp
goo.hpp
Please, commit your changes or stash them before you can merge.
Aborting
Completed with errors, see above.